My home coming is to repent, not to cause trouble - Ariyo

Date: 2016-06-02

Alleged mastermind of last year's clash in Agbarere and Idi-Ape Communities of Ilorin, Olatunji Ibrahim popularly known as Ariyo, yesterday opened up on his detention at the custody of Kwara Police Command.

Ariyo, who was arrested recently was on Tuesday, paraded alongside alleged killer-lover, David Ogundele and some suspected cultists. They are Lukman Oladimeji, known as Zanda and Akeem Olayinka also known as Student. The State Commissioner of Police, Sam Okaula at the press briefing held at the Police Headquarters, Ilorin, said: "The command in its determination to fish out the culprit set up intelligence based unit which promptly arrested the said David Ogundele at Oba Ile town in Osun state".

The CP also said David has confessed to the crime allegedly committed. According to CP, seven suspected cultists were also arrested by the operatives of SARS while on intelligence patrol at Oke-Onigbin and Oko axis. The Commissioner added that the suspects would be arraigned at the court as soon as the police completed their investigation. Speaking with National Pilot, Ariyo said: "I did not fight with Agberere people intentionally. It was because one of my boys was 'dropped down' by the NDLEA men during the exchange of gun fire in a conflict.

"The officer came to our camp that he wanted to smoke weed, and one of my boys discovered that he was an undercover officer, disguised to be weed smoker. My boys tried to fight him and he ran out. He was given hot chase by my boys but he was lucky to be rescued by his colleagues. "That was how the trouble began. I lost one of my boys to those officers during a cross-fire. I was hinted that one of their officers lived at Agberere and we went to destroy his house too.

"When I heard that police was looking for me I ran to Lagos after the incident. I stayed at Isale Eko along Oja Oba area. That was where I stayed for some months but I'm tired of running. "That is why I came back to Ilorin. My home coming is not to cause trouble but to repent and seek for forgiveness. "I was squatting with one of my street younger brothers who is student at Kwara Poly at Eleko Yangan. That was how I got arrested while sleeping."

"I wanted to seek for forgiveness to go back to my former business as a meat seller. "I was selling India hemp before but I left the business in 2013. I began to sell meat at Mandate Market." On his part, David claimed to have been under spell when he killed his lover.
